The transgender Laramie resident who staged a protest at the state Capitol last summer of Wyoming’s new cross-sex access ban for public restrooms is now waging a self-defense argument in a felony aggravated assault case. Rihanna Kelver, 26, made headlines last summer for using the women’s bathroom in the Wyoming Capitol when a new state law activated banning the practice. The ban doesn’t allow for penalties against a transgender person using the women’s bathroom, but allows females aggrieved by that event to sue the state for letting it happen.
